Responsibilities

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• * Perform all work adhering to MSHA and H&K Safety policies
  • * Drives truck into position to load at filling rack
  • * Opens valves or starts pumps to fill tank
  • * Reads gauges or meters and records quantity loaded
  • * Drives truck to customer's premises
  • * Connects hose to tank and opens valves
  • * Records amount delivered and issues ticket to customer
  • * Attaches ground wire to truck
  • * Maintains truck log according to state and federal regulations and company policy
  • * Maintains telephone or radio contact with supervisor to receive delivery instructions
  • * Loads and unloads truck
  • * Inspects truck equipment and supplies such as tires, lights, brakes, gas, oil, and water
  • * Performs daily pre and post trip of vehicle
  • * Other duties as assigned
